LEGAL PROFESSION UNIFORM LAW (NSW) - SECT 46

Notification of principal place of practice

46 Notification of principal place of practice

(1) If an Australian lawyer reasonably intends that this jurisdiction will be his or her principal place of practice, he or she must notify the designated local regulatory authority of that intention--
(a) on application for the grant or renewal of an Australian practising certificate in this jurisdiction; and
(b) within 14 days after his or her principal place of practice changes, if that change coincides with the move to this jurisdiction from another jurisdiction of the permanent office in or through which the lawyer engages in legal practice.
(2) The designated local regulatory authority may reject the notification if it considers that it is reasonably likely that another jurisdiction will be the Australian lawyer's principal place of practice.
